Today, 30 March 2014, the Orthodox Christians are on the 4th Sunday of the Lent, also called of Saint John Climacus. The pericope of the Gospel of Saint Mark about the Healing of the man with an unclean spirit was read during the Divine Liturgy in all the places of worship of the Romanian Patriarchate. The weaker the faith of the people the stronger the power of the evil spirits over the people We learn from the Bible text that the weak faith strengthens the work of the devil over the man, said His Beatitude Daniel, Patriarch of Romania, in the sermon delivered at Samurcasesti Monastery. “Very often the demons have power over the people when the faith of the people weakens. The weaker the faith of the people the stronger the evil spirits are over the people making them grumble, revolt or utter blasphemy against God when they suffer, especially when an innocent child is suffering. Very often, when they suffer the people weak in faith revolt or utter blasphemy against God instead of going closer to Him and pray for His help”. The words “help my lack of faith” confirm once more the repentance united with lowliness The devoted repentance of the father of today’s Gospel brought about the healing of his sick son, His Beatitude has also shown. “”In the first part of his words, I believe God, help my lack of faith, the father of the sick child shows that he was strengthened in his faith, while in the second part he shows that he was strengthened in lowliness, admitting that his faith was not strong enough to get the healing of his son. We see in the words of the poor father two attitudes complementary from a spiritual point of view: first of all his tears show his state of repentance because he had little faith mixed with doubt. The words I believe, God show his desire to strengthen his faith, while the words help my lack of faith confirm one more time the repentance united with his lowliness”. Christ, our Lord, teaches us how necessary is the faith united with fasting which heals passions and helplessness, the Primate of the Romanian Orthodox Church pointed out. “The Church scheduled this part of the Gospel according to Saint Mark the Evangelist for the Lent time, especially because it is a time of ardent prayer and much fasting in order to strengthen our faith and fight against sin, bad passions and evil spirits”. Next Sunday, the Orthodox Church will be on the 5th Sunday of the Lent or of Pious Mary the Egyptian.
